Transaction deb3eba37039e2286ebb565d7e91b92f83180e12d38a03d6d56439113e9a4f91
1 Input
1 Output
-
deb3eba37039e2286ebb565d7e91b92f83180e12d38a03d6d56439113e9a4f91:0
- value
- 3997708
- script pubkey
- OP_0 OP_PUSHBYTES_20 313e0f953a230f5dca14fe57c8c2d066e9b7dae8
- address
- bc1qxylql9f6yv84mjs5letu3sksvm5m0khg6thl59